Ugandan Fish Stew with Tomatoes

A flavorful and aromatic fish stew, this dish highlights fresh fish simmered in a rich tomato-based broth with a blend of Ugandan spices. It's a comforting and relatively quick meal, often served with rice, posho, or matoke.

๐Ÿง‚ Ingredients

  • 500 g Tilapia or other firm white fish fillets(cut into 2-inch pieces)
  • 2 tablespoons Vegetable oil
  • 2 medium Onions(chopped)
  • 4 cloves Garlic(minced)
  • 1 inch piece Ginger(grated)
  • 4 medium Tomatoes(chopped)
  • 1 medium Green bell pepper(chopped)
  • 1 tablespoon Cumin powder
  • 1 tablespoon Pa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Turmeric powder
  • to taste Salt
  • 1.5 cups Water
  • 1/4 cup Coriander leaves(chopped, for garnish)

๐Ÿ’ก Pro Tips

  • โœ“Use fresh fish for the best flavor.
  • โœ“Adjust the amount of spices to your preference.
  • โœ“If you prefer a thicker stew, you can mash some of the tomatoes against the side of the pot.

โœจ Twist Ideas

Inspiration for your own version of this recipe

  • Add other vegetables like carrots or potatoes.
  • For a touch of heat, add a chopped chili pepper along with the tomatoes.
  • Smoked fish can be used for a different flavor profile.
